Abstract: The present invention relates to a device for use in steplessly detecting the presence and the precise position of ovalizations, squashings or swellings into a submerged pipeline as well as the projections on a vertical plane and on a horizontal plane respectively of the curved geometrical configuration of said pipeline.

Abstract: An apparatus for surveying the configuration of a submarine pipeline during its laying including a carriage carrying depth sensing and distance sensing means and adapted to be rolled along the pipe between the pipe laying ship and the bottom of the body of water. Depth and distance are simultaneously recorded.

Abstract: The present invention relates to an apparatus suitable for use in the automatic welding of pipes. The apparatus according to the invention comprises a fixed part or rail band which is clamped around the pipe at a prefixed position and a moving part which is driven with an orbital motion along the rail band and supports a swinging welding torch, a welding rod feeding mechanism and a torch position adjusting mechanism. The swinging motion of the welding torch is produced by a pneumatic system which permits both the amplitude and the frequency of said swinging motion to be adjusted. It is also possible to produce high swing frequencies and various times of stoppage for the torch at the ends of the swinging motion.

Abstract: This invention relates to an improved method for rapidly laying a pipeline in deep water by an anchored floating means. The rapid laying is obtained by varying the forces exerted by winches mounted on the floating means in such a manner as to impart a rapid movement to the floating means, in the longitudinal direction of laying, for a distance equal to the length of the piece of pipe added to the free end of the pipeline to be laid. Before termination of the rapid movement there is applied to the floating means a compensating force, whose direction, sense and intensity are such that, together with the forces exerted by the winches, said compensating force opposes moment by moment the central elastic force which induces a damped oscillatory motion in the floating means. This oscillation is thus eliminated or drastically and rapidly dampened.

Abstract: A method is disclosed for repairing a damaged pipe laid on deep sea beds, said method substantially comprising the step of joining a central pipe stub between the ends of the two adjoining pipe portions, such operation being performed directly on the sea bed rather than on the pipe-laying barge. Special coupling sleeves are provided at both ends of the central pipe stub, said sleeves being received in a watertight manner on the two pipe terminal portions, by clamping said sleeves thereon. Apparatus and tools for carrying out said method are described in great detail.
